Basic facts about this digital color

In the Register's classification, #0EAFBD belongs to the Cyan Color Family, featuring Full Saturation and Neutral brightness. In numbers: rgb(14, 175, 189) (5.5% red, 68.6% green, 74.1% blue), or CMYK 69 / 5 / 0 / 26 for print.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

#0EAFBD presents itself as a pure, full-strength water-like cyan — one that occupies the middle of the lightness scale. It is a natural fit for accents, call-to-action elements and statement visuals. In The Official Register of Color Names it is just a few steps away from Pacific Blue (#1CA9C9). Slightly further away sit AITriedPume (#13B6A9) and Blue Green (#0D98BA).

The recipe behind #0EAFBD is rgb(14, 175, 189), with blue as the dominant ingredient. Accessibility-wise, black text works best on #0EAFBD: 7.9:1 contrast (passing WCAG AAA) versus 2.7:1 for white. #0EAFBD color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
